您当前位置附近500米内的酒店信息查询,方便您快速找到合适的住宿选择。本查询结果仅供参考,请根据实际需求进行选择。
以下结果基于模拟数据,实际结果可能存在差异。请参考酒店官网或相关平台获取更准确的信息。
如何获取更准确的查询结果?
-
使用在线酒店预订平台:如Booking.com、携程等,输入目的地和日期,即可查找更详细的酒店信息。
-
使用地图应用:如高德地图、百度地图等,搜索“附近酒店”,查看地图上显示的酒店。
-
咨询当地居民:向当地居民或旅游咨询中心询问附近的酒店信息。
希望以上信息对您有所帮助!
说明和改进:模拟数据: 代码现在使用 `hotels` 数组模拟酒店数据。实际应用中,你需要使用酒店API或数据库获取数据。动态生成列表: 使用 JavaScript 动态生成酒店列表,避免了硬编码;响应式布局: 使用 `max-width: 800px;` 保证在不同屏幕尺寸上布局不会出现问题。更清晰的样式: CSS 样式更加简洁,并添加了图片显示和布局优化。图片处理: 添加了图片元素,并设置了 `max-width` 属性,使图片能够自适应宽度,避免图片过大。提示信息: 添加了说明,提醒用户实际结果可能与模拟数据有差异。数据格式: 酒店数据格式更规范,包括名称、地址、距离、价格和图片链接。实用建议: 提供了获取更准确查询结果的建议,例如使用在线预订平台或地图应用。HTML结构: 使用语义化的HTML元素(如 `
`、`
`),使代码结构清晰易读。为了使用这个代码,你需要:1. 替换图片链接: `hotel1.jpg`, `hotel2.jpg`, `hotel3.jpg` 等文件名/路径应该替换为你实际的图片文件。
2. 连接到真实的API或数据库: 将模拟的 `hotels`数组替换成通过酒店API或数据库查询得到的结果。
3. 用户位置获取: 实际应用中需要获取用户当前位置,使用 Geolocation API 确定附近 500 米的酒店。```javascript// 获取用户位置 (示例)if (navigator.geolocation) {navigator.geolocation.getCurrentPosition(position => {// 使用 position.coords.latitude 和 position.coords.longitude 获取附近酒店});} else {// 用户浏览器不支持地理位置}```
4. API请求处理:使用 JavaScript 的 `fetch` API 或其他方法来处理与酒店API的通信。
5. 错误处理: 添加错误处理机制来应对网络问题或API调用失败。进一步改进:排序功能: 根据距离或价格对酒店进行排序。过滤功能: 允许用户按星级、类型等条件过滤酒店。用户界面优化: 例如,添加酒店的星级评级、评论等。分页: 如果酒店数量很多,使用分页。地图集成: 在网页上显示酒店在地图上的位置。这个改进后的代码更贴近实际需求,可以作为构建一个更完善的“附近酒店查询”功能的基础。请根据你的实际情况进行调整和完善。记住,真正的应用需要使用 API 和数据库来获取酒店信息,并进行地理定位和数据处理,这里只是一个展示。
本文由:成都民宿于(2025-03-02)发表了关于
附近酒店查询住宿 (附近酒店查询500米内)的文章
。如转载请注明出处:http://www.cdcy-mail.com
如果您对此感兴趣,可以通过以下联系方式与我们联系:
成都区销售
重庆区销售
云贵区销售
华南区销售
华北区销售
华东区销售
华为企业邮箱销售热线:400-0828-083